Descripción del empleo

Plan, organize, and direct quality assurance programs and activities. Develop, implement and coordinate QA and assessment programs to enhance resident care. Attends any required facility specific meetings/committees which support the facility QAPI program. Monitors trends and prepares quality reports for the QAPI committee. Develops processes in conjunction with the QAPI Committee to assess systems of care including clinical care, quality of life, and resident choice. Identifies need for education based on findings and trends. Elicits data from facility identified systems to monitor care and services with findings compared to benchmarks and targets the faculty has established for performance. Works collaboratively with the Interdisciplinary team (IDT) to provide education/training based on findings. Tracking, monitoring and investigation of adverse events with identified action plan. Oversight of Facility Infection control program which includes process of identification, reporting, surveillance, and investigation of communicable diseases and infections. Participation in correction of State and Federal survey deficiency corrections as appropriate. Attend facility in service training programs (i.e. HIPAA, Abuse Prevention, Infection Control, etc.) Maintains the utmost level of confidentiality. Report suspected or known breaches.
